*1 : This parameter is based on VSS = PLLVSS = 0 V.
*2 : Note that analog power supply voltage and input voltage do not exceed VDDE + 0.3 V at power on.
*3 : The maximum output current is the peak value for a single pin.
*4 : The average output current is the average current for a single pin over a period of 100 ms.
*5 : The total average output current is the average current for all pins over a period of 100 ms.
WARNING: Semiconductor devices can be permanently damaged by application of stress (voltage, current, temperature, etc.) in excess of absolute maximum ratings. Do not exceed these ratings.
Notes : • Apply equal potential to all of the VDDE pins.
•Apply equal potential to all of the VDDI pins.
•Fix all of the VSS pins at 0 V.
•Leave N.C. pins open.
